Crafted Live: Wollongong’s first ever BBQ, craft beer and music festival announced for April

This Easter, Wollongong is grilling up to become a part of the growing barbecue scene as Crafted Live: Brewed & BBQ’d launches at MacCabe Park. The Australian Barbecue Alliance (ABA) has sanctioned this one of a kind event to showcase low n’ slow competition BBQ, along with a heady dose of a craft beer & cider, live music from Aussie rocker Tex Perkins and blues musician Ash Grunwald, masterclasses and more.

The inaugural Crafted LIVE launched in Orange, NSW in 2016. Wollongong’s Crafted Live: Brewed & BBQ’d will kick off Saturday 15th April 11am – 8pm & Sunday 16th April 10am – 5pm. Winners of channel Seven’s Aussie Barbecue Heroes, the Skank brothers will host the event with 30 barbecue teams competing for the Grand Champion Trophy and a share of over $9,000 in cash and prizes.

Some of the top BBQ food vendors will be on hand to keep the public well fed, including Black Iron BBQ Smokers, Smokin Hot & Saucy, Artisan Flame and Berlin Bangers. The competition element of the event will comprise of 30 BBQ teams competing across six meat categories; Beef, Pork, Pork Ribs, Lamb, Chicken & Chef’s Choice. Competitors will be travelling from most states & territories of Australia for the event, which will also feature local Wollongong teams the Sheen Shangri La, Dave’s Texas BBQ and The Beard and the BBQ. The Blue Mountain’s all-female BBQ team Pit’s Perfect is also tossing their hats in the ring.

The ‘Brewed’ component of the event features 20 of Australia’s best craft brewers & cider-makers showcasing their products, and includes local Wollongong favourites Southern Brewers, Illawarra Brewing Co, Shark Island Brewing and Five Barrel Brewing. Patrons will be able to sample a range of beers & ciders throughout the afternoon and evening.

Along with the craft beer & BBQ festival will be live music headlined on Saturday 15th April by Melbourne rock identities Tex Perkins & The Ape, and then on Sunday 16th April by Blues & Roots legend, Ash Grunwald. Local talent including Joe Mungovan, The Lonesome Train, Big Erle and Patrick Lyons and the American Creek Band are also locked in to perform.

There will also be a range of masterclasses available, where patrons can get to taste, smell & learn from some of the best BBQ’ers & brewers in the business including; Australia’s very own Beer Diva Kirrily Wadhorn who will be running a master class pairing beers with cheeses and quizzing craft brewers on a range of brewing techniques.
